I have posted on the Gurtenprint developer mailing list and got as answer that 
the Canon
Pixma iP1600 support did not actually work in 5.2.7 and therefore got
removed in 5.2.8. So we do not have a regression, this printer has never
worked under Ubuntu with only the included drivers.

You will have to use a Canon driver for this printer, but note that we
cannot fix any bugs or incompatibilities in Canon's drivers. Please
contact Canon in case of problems.

Closing the Gutenprint (Ubuntu) task...
